Output 44c5d27ef1abfd5a22bb43fe0f4692dc2273797008f135e42f157678c2c6e387:20

value
1581645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01dd8c81eac4ead9f374a697f3f782f24df77d57 OP_EQUAL
address
31rt1DiY99oreVBMz3b8DpBhfsjVQ3zvwm
transaction
44c5d27ef1abfd5a22bb43fe0f4692dc2273797008f135e42f157678c2c6e387
confirmations
231322
spent
true